How to Achieve Oral Health Through Diet: The Close Link Between Diet and Oral Health

1. Introduction

Oral health is not only related to our appearance and social interactions, but also has a significant impact on overall health. Whether it is the appearance of our teeth or basic functions like chewing and speaking, oral health plays a vital role. In recent years, research has increasingly shown that there is a close relationship between diet and oral health. Poor dietary habits, especially high sugar and acidic foods, can lead to cavities, gum disease, and other oral problems, while a healthy, balanced diet can effectively prevent these issues, protecting teeth and gums.

This article will explore how to protect oral health through diet, analyzing the impact of different foods on oral health, daily dietary recommendations for maintaining oral hygiene, and the necessary nutrients for healthy teeth. By adopting healthy eating habits, individuals can protect their teeth from the inside out and maintain optimal oral health.

2. The Impact of Diet on Oral Health

2.1 The Basic Concept of Oral Health

Oral health refers to not only the absence of cavities or gum bleeding but also the normal functioning of teeth, healthy gums, and fresh breath. Oral health is closely linked to overall health, as bacteria in the mouth can enter the bloodstream and affect vital organs such as the heart and kidneys. Therefore, maintaining good oral health is fundamental to overall health.

The main functions of teeth include chewing food, speaking, and maintaining the structure of the face. The appearance and structure of teeth are closely related to our eating habits and oral care. By following proper eating habits and nutrition, we can prevent the degeneration of teeth, the development of cavities, and other oral issues.

2.2 How Diet Affects Oral Health

Diet plays a direct role in oral health in the following ways:

  1. Prevention of Cavities: Sugar is a major contributor to tooth decay. Oral bacteria feed on sugar, and as they metabolize it, they produce acidic substances that dissolve the tooth enamel, leading to cavities. Therefore, reducing sugar intake is crucial for preventing cavities.
  2. Promoting Tooth Repair: Calcium, phosphorus, and fluoride are essential minerals for tooth structure. A proper diet can help provide these necessary minerals, aiding in the repair and remineralization of teeth, preventing demineralization.
  3. Gum Health: Vitamins such as Vitamin C and other essential nutrients are crucial for gum health. Deficiencies in Vitamin C can lead to bleeding gums, swelling, and even gum disease. A balanced diet helps strengthen the immune system, improving gum resistance to disease.
  4. Reducing Bacterial Growth in the Mouth: The texture of food and the chewing process can help stimulate saliva production, which helps clean food particles and neutralize acids in the mouth, thus preventing plaque buildup and bacterial growth.

2.3 The Negative Impact of Poor Dietary Habits on Oral Health

Poor dietary habits are one of the leading causes of oral problems. Common dietary issues include:

  1. Excessive Sugar Intake: Consuming too much sugar leads to rapid bacterial growth in the mouth, producing acids that attack tooth enamel. Especially frequent consumption of sugary beverages, snacks, and sweets increases the risk of cavities.
  2. Excessive Consumption of Acidic Foods: Acidic foods and beverages, such as citrus fruits, orange juice, and carbonated drinks, can erode enamel. Over time, they weaken the tooth’s structure and make it more susceptible to cavities and sensitivity.
  3. Sticky Foods: Sticky foods such as candies, chocolates, and chewy snacks can linger on the teeth for longer periods, increasing the risk of cavities.
  4. Insufficient Water Intake: Inadequate water intake leads to dry mouth, reduced saliva production, and insufficient cleansing of food particles and bacteria, increasing the likelihood of oral problems.

3. How to Protect Oral Health Through Diet

3.1 Increase Intake of Calcium, Phosphorus, and Fluoride

Calcium, phosphorus, and fluoride are essential for maintaining healthy teeth. They help to strengthen tooth enamel, promote remineralization, and prevent cavities.

3.1.1 Calcium Intake

Calcium is one of the most important minerals for teeth. It helps maintain the strength and integrity of tooth enamel. Good sources of calcium include dairy products (such as milk, cheese, and yogurt), leafy green vegetables (such as spinach and broccoli), and nuts (such as almonds and sesame seeds). Children and teenagers need adequate calcium for proper tooth development, while adults and older individuals should ensure sufficient calcium intake to prevent tooth degeneration.

3.1.2 Phosphorus Intake

Phosphorus works alongside calcium to build strong teeth and bones. The main sources of phosphorus include eggs, fish, poultry, legumes, and whole grains. Phosphorus, along with calcium, helps improve the strength of teeth and prevents tooth decay.

3.1.3 Fluoride Intake

Fluoride strengthens the enamel and protects teeth from decay. Fluoride helps in remineralizing teeth, repairing minor damage caused by acids. Fluoride can be obtained through fluoridated water, toothpaste, and certain foods like tea and seafood. Proper fluoride intake enhances tooth resistance to decay, especially in the early stages of tooth decay.

3.2 Increase Vitamin C Intake

Vitamin C is essential for maintaining healthy gums. It boosts gum health, strengthens the immune system, and prevents gum disease. Good sources of Vitamin C include citrus fruits (such as oranges and grapefruits), strawberries, tomatoes, and leafy green vegetables (such as spinach and bell peppers). A deficiency in Vitamin C can cause bleeding gums, swelling, and inflammation, affecting overall oral health.

3.3 Control Sugar Intake

Sugar is the primary cause of tooth decay. When we consume sugar, bacteria in the mouth feed on it and produce acids that break down enamel. Reducing sugar intake is one of the most effective ways to protect teeth. Avoid sugary drinks, snacks, and desserts as much as possible. If consuming sugar is unavoidable, try to consume it during meals rather than between meals. Additionally, brush your teeth or rinse your mouth after eating sugary foods to minimize the damage caused by sugar.

3.4 Limit Acidic Foods and Beverages

Although acidic foods have health benefits, excessive consumption can erode tooth enamel. Frequent consumption of citrus fruits, carbonated beverages, and sour candies can lead to enamel erosion. To minimize the effects of acidic foods on your teeth, consume them in moderation and rinse your mouth with water afterward to neutralize the acids. Using a straw when drinking acidic beverages can also help reduce direct contact with teeth.

3.5 Drink Plenty of Water to Keep the Mouth Moist

Water is the most natural and effective way to clean the mouth. Drinking water throughout the day helps wash away food particles and bacteria, reducing plaque buildup. Water also maintains proper saliva levels in the mouth, which is crucial for neutralizing acids and protecting tooth enamel. Drink plenty of water throughout the day to keep your mouth clean and hydrated.

3.6 Choose Hard Foods to Promote Natural Cleaning

Chewing hard foods such as raw vegetables, apples, and nuts not only strengthens teeth but also helps clean them naturally. These foods stimulate saliva production, which aids in the removal of food debris and bacteria from the mouth. Additionally, hard foods help massage the gums and reduce plaque buildup, further preventing tooth decay and gum disease.

4. Additional Considerations for Oral Health

4.1 Regular Dental Check-ups

In addition to maintaining good dietary habits, regular dental check-ups are essential for ensuring oral health. Regular visits to the dentist help detect problems early and take timely action to treat them, preventing oral diseases from worsening.

4.2 Good Oral Hygiene Habits

Good oral hygiene includes brushing teeth, using dental floss, and rinsing with mouthwash. Brush your teeth at least twice a day for two minutes each time. Use dental floss to clean between your teeth, and use fluoride mouthwash to reduce bacteria and plaque buildup in the mouth.

5. Conclusion

Diet is an essential foundation for maintaining oral health. Good dietary habits can effectively prevent cavities, gum disease, and other oral problems while promoting the appearance and function of teeth. By choosing the right foods, increasing intake of essential minerals like calcium, phosphorus, and fluoride, reducing sugar and acidic foods, staying hydrated, and including natural tooth-cleaning foods in your diet, you can protect your teeth from the inside out. Combined with proper oral care habits and regular dental check-ups, you can achieve long-term oral health.
